Table 2:

Proportion of patients with resolution of symptoms on day 7*

Symptom resolvedGroup; % (no.) of patientsAbsolute risk difference, % (95% CI)Relative risk
(95% CI)
Prednisolone
n = 88
Placebo
n = 86
Facial pain or pressure62.5 (55/88)55.8 (48/86)6.7 (−7.9 to 21.2)1.12 (0.87 to 1.44)
Severe facial pain or pressure93.2 (82/88)82.6 (71/86)10.6 (1.0 to 20.2)1.13 (1.01 to 1.26)
Nasal congestion57.5 (50/87)53.5 (46/86)4.0 (−10.8 to 18.8)1.07 (0.82 to 1.40)
Postnasal discharge54.5 (48/88)57.6 (49/85)−3.0 (−17.9 to 11.7)0.95 (0.73 to 1.23)
Runny nose69.3 (61/88)58.1 (50/86)11.2 (−3.0 to 25.3)1.19 (0.95 to 1.50)
Cough66.3 (57/86)54.8 (46/84)11.5 (−3.1 to 26.1)1.21 (0.95 to 1.55)
Total symptoms32.9 (28/85)25.3 (21/83)7.6 (−6.1 to 21.3)1.30 (0.81 to 2.10)
Severe total symptoms81.2 (69/85)78.3 (65/83)2.9 (−9.3 to 15.0)1.04 (0.89 to 1.21)
4 of 5 total symptoms44.7 (38/85)39.8 (33/83)5.0 (−10.0 to 19.9)1.12 (0.79 to 1.60)
3 of 5 total symptoms62.4 (53/85)57.8 (48/83)4.5 (−10.3 to 19.3)1.08 (0.84 to 1.38)
  • Note: CI = confidence interval.

  • * Defined as a symptom score of 0 (normal or no problem) or 1 (very mild problem).

  • Defined as the absence of severe pain or pressure (score of 4 or 5) regardless of the baseline severity score.

  • Complete symptom relief of runny nose, postnasal discharge, nasal congestion, cough and facial pain or pressure.
